WebThis bread is mostly called pita nowadays around the world because the word entered the Oxford English Dictionary from the Greek πίτα (pita). The word pita could originate from the Ancient greek πικτή ( pikte) meaning “fermented pastry”. The word might have derived later into picta in Latin and derived again in pita. WebFeb 23, 2024 · Cooking the Grilled Chicken for the Pitas. Preheat the grill to 450 degrees F. After marinating, remove the chicken from the marinade, and pat dry. Cook the chicken on the preheated grill for 5 minutes per side, or until the chicken reaches 165 degrees F internal temperature. Remove the chicken from the grill. WebJun 14, 2024 · Pita bread's history can be traced back at least 4,000 years. While we know that pita bread was created in the Mediterranean around the 21st century B.C., it's up for debate as to whether it was first made by the Amorites or Bedouins — two groups of people who lived in the region during the era (via Bodrum ). WebApr 3, 2024 · Ingredients You’ll Need To Make Pita Bread All-purpose flour: All-purpose flour supports a perfectly soft and airy texture. You could also try using whole wheat flour if you want something a little heartier. Yeast: Yeast is what makes the dough rise and helps aerate it for a light and fluffy bite.
